Cryptohopper
45 mentions across 3 sources · 58% positive — mixed
YouTube, Product Hunt, App Store
What users praise
- • Comprehensive feature set: DCA, trailing stops, market making, arbitrage.
- • No-code Strategy Designer with over 130 indicators for personalized bots.
- • Social trading: copy experienced traders via Copy Bot and Marketplace templates.
- • Paper trading and backtesting tools to practice without risking funds.
What frustrates them
- • Mobile app crashes, login issues, and verification code problems.
- • Exchange API setup is unreliable, especially with Crypto.com.
- • Customer support AI is ineffective; hours wasted without resolution.
- • Pricing is high, with additional paid features needed for full functionality.

Can Cryptohopper be used for things other than crypto trading?
No, Cryptohopper is exclusively for crypto trading with exchange integrations.
Does OrderPost support automatic payment processing?
No, OrderPost only supports manual payments like Venmo, Zelle, Cash App, or cash; no integrated payment gateway.

Does Cryptohopper have a free plan?
No, Cryptohopper has a 3-day trial, then requires a paid plan starting at $24.16/month.
Does OrderPost have a free plan?
Yes, OrderPost Free caps at 30 orders/month; Pro at $19/month removes limits and adds analytics.
Can order volume affect performance on OrderPost?
Free plan has a 30/month cap; Pro is unlimited, but payments remain manual.
Does Cryptohopper work with decentralized exchanges?
No, it only integrates with centralized exchanges like Binance, Coinbase Pro, Kraken, KuCoin, etc.
